I found a military trailer recently and used it to move some storage. Doing about 55-65 mph on the freeway for a couple of hours and the tread started to come off one of the tires. I found some of these tires at IFA, Intermountain Farmers Association for $159 a piece. http://www.garbee.net/~cabell/december/tires/gripspur.JPG

There is not a speed rating on these. I am just wondering what speeds I can safely go without having any troubles. Some say its a military/farm tire don't go over 45, others say whatever.
